Solve the system using elimination 4x-7y=3
x-7y=-15

Answer: x=6 and y=3

Explanation:

4x - 7y = 3 -------(1)

x - 7y = -15 ------(2)

equation(1) - equation (2)

3x = 18

Divide bothside by 3

x = 18/3

x= 6

also, multiply equation (2) by 4

4x - 28y = -60--------------(3)

subtract equation(3) from equation(1)

21y = 63

divide bothside by 21

y = 63/21

y = 3
